Benefits and drawbacks of Metal Roofing
Steel roofing supplies an engaging combination of longevity and power efficiency, making it a preferred option among property owners. One considerable benefit is its long life-span; metal roof coverings can last half a century or more with appropriate maintenance.
They're additionally immune to severe weather, including heavy snow, rain, and wind. Furthermore, steel shows sunshine, which helps in reducing cooling costs in warm environments.
However, there are some drawbacks to take into consideration. Metal roof can be a lot more costly in advance contrasted to traditional products, which might strain your budget.
Installment can also be tricky, requiring competent professionals to ensure a proper fit and seal. If you reside in a loud location, you might locate that during hefty rainfall or hailstorm, the noise can be enhanced, potentially troubling your tranquility.
One more indicate think about is the aesthetic selection. While steel roof coverings come in different styles and shades, they mightn't suit every building style.
If you're searching for that timeless look, you might really feel metal isn't the most effective fit.
Inevitably, considering these pros and cons will assist you determine if metal roof covering aligns with your requirements and preferences for your home.
Benefits and drawbacks of Asphalt Roofing Shingles
Asphalt roof shingles are among the most prominent roof products for property owners due to their affordability and convenience of setup. They can be found in a range of colors and styles, enabling you to match your home's aesthetic.
Among the largest advantages is the expense; asphalt roof shingles are typically less costly than various other roof covering products. Their installment is straightforward, making it fast and convenient for service providers to place them on your roofing system.
However, there are some drawbacks to take into consideration. Asphalt tiles normally have a shorter life-span, averaging around 15 to three decades, depending on the high quality.
They're additionally prone to damage from high winds and hail, which can lead to expensive repairs. Furthermore, roof and gutter cleaning near me aren't one of the most eco-friendly option, as they're petroleum-based and can add to garbage dump waste at the end of their life.
